/packages/apps/TV/common/src/com/android/tv/common/ |
H A D | TvCommonUtils.java | 32 public static Intent createSetupIntent(Intent originalSetupIntent, String inputId) { argument 40 intentContainer.putExtra(TvCommonConstants.EXTRA_INPUT_ID, inputId);
|
/packages/apps/TV/src/com/android/tv/dvr/ |
H A D | WritableDvrDataManager.java | 77 void forgetStorage(String inputId); argument
|
H A D | BaseDvrDataManager.java | 321 public void forgetStorage(String inputId) { } argument
|
H A D | DvrDataManager.java | 89 List<SeriesRecording> getSeriesRecordings(String inputId); argument 120 List<ScheduledRecording> getScheduledRecordings(String inputId); argument
|
H A D | DvrUiHelper.java | 121 * @return true if the storage status is fine to be recorded for {@code inputId}. 123 public static boolean checkStorageStatusAndShowErrorMessage(Activity activity, String inputId) { argument 124 if (!Utils.isBundledInput(inputId)) { 134 showDvrMissingStorageErrorDialog(activity, inputId); 204 private static void showDvrMissingStorageErrorDialog(Activity activity, String inputId) { argument 205 SoftPreconditions.checkArgument(!TextUtils.isEmpty(inputId)); 207 args.putString(DvrHalfSizedDialogFragment.KEY_INPUT_ID, inputId);
|
H A D | Scheduler.java | 269 public void onInputUpdated(String inputId) { argument 270 InputTaskScheduler scheduler = mInputSchedulerMap.get(inputId); 272 scheduler.updateTvInputInfo(Utils.getTvInputInfoForInputId(mContext, inputId));
|
H A D | DvrManager.java | 226 private void addScheduleInternal(String inputId, long channelId, long startTime, long endTime) { argument 228 .builder(inputId, channelId, startTime, endTime) 759 private ScheduledRecording.Builder createScheduledRecordingBuilder(String inputId, argument 761 ScheduledRecording.Builder builder = ScheduledRecording.builder(inputId, program); 836 public void forgetStorage(String inputId) { argument 838 mDataManager.forgetStorage(inputId);
|
/packages/apps/TV/tests/common/src/com/android/tv/testing/ |
H A D | ChannelUtils.java | 51 Context context, String inputId) { 52 Uri uri = TvContract.buildChannelsUriForInput(inputId); 70 public static void updateChannels(Context context, String inputId, List<ChannelInfo> channels) { argument 73 Uri channelsUri = TvContract.buildChannelsUriForInput(inputId); 88 values.put(Channels.COLUMN_INPUT_ID, inputId); 50 queryChannelInfoMapForTvInput( Context context, String inputId) argument
|
H A D | Utils.java | 75 public static String getServiceNameFromInputId(Context context, String inputId) { argument 78 if (info.getId().equals(inputId)) {
|
/packages/apps/TV/tests/input/src/com/android/tv/testinput/ |
H A D | TestTvInputSetupActivity.java | 64 public static void registerChannels(Context context, String inputId, boolean updateBrowsable, argument 71 ChannelUtils.updateChannels(context, inputId, channels); 73 updateChannelsBrowsable(context.getContentResolver(), inputId); 78 ChannelUtils.queryChannelInfoMapForTvInput(context, inputId); 87 private static void updateChannelsBrowsable(ContentResolver contentResolver, String inputId) { argument 88 Uri uri = TvContract.buildChannelsUriForInput(inputId);
|
H A D | TestInputControl.java | 60 public synchronized void init(Context context, String inputId) { argument 63 mInputId = inputId;
|
/packages/apps/TV/src/com/android/tv/dvr/ui/list/ |
H A D | EpisodicProgramRow.java | 32 public EpisodicProgramRow(String inputId, Program program, ScheduledRecording recording, argument 35 mInputId = inputId; 85 + "(inputId=" + mInputId
|
/packages/apps/TV/src/com/android/tv/tuner/tvinput/ |
H A D | TunerRecordingSession.java | 37 public TunerRecordingSession(Context context, String inputId, argument 40 mSessionWorker = new TunerRecordingSessionWorker(context, inputId, channelDataManager,
|
H A D | TunerTvInputService.java | 101 public RecordingSession onCreateRecordingSession(String inputId) { argument 102 return new TunerRecordingSession(this, inputId, mChannelDataManager); 106 public Session onCreateSession(String inputId) { argument 117 Log.e(TAG, "Creating a session for " + inputId + " failed.", e);
|
/packages/apps/TV/tests/common/src/com/android/tv/testing/dvr/ |
H A D | RecordingTestUtils.java | 30 public static ScheduledRecording createTestRecordingWithIdAndPeriod(long id, String inputId, argument 32 return ScheduledRecording.builder(inputId, channelId, startTime, endTime) 38 public static ScheduledRecording createTestRecordingWithPeriod(String inputId, argument 40 return createTestRecordingWithIdAndPeriod(ScheduledRecording.ID_NOT_SET, inputId, channelId,
|
/packages/apps/TV/common/src/com/android/tv/common/recording/ |
H A D | RecordingCapability.java | 29 * The inputId this capability represents. 31 public final String inputId; field in class:RecordingCapability 60 private RecordingCapability(String inputId, int maxConcurrentTunedSessions, argument 63 this.inputId = inputId; 71 inputId = in.readString(); 80 parcel.writeString(inputId); 101 Objects.equals(inputId, that.inputId); 106 return Objects.hash(inputId); 148 setInputId(String inputId) argument [all...] |
/packages/apps/TV/src/com/android/tv/tuner/ |
H A D | DvbDeviceAccessor.java | 128 * @param inputId the input id to use. 130 public RecordingCapability getRecordingCapability(String inputId) { argument 134 .setInputId(inputId)
|
/packages/apps/TV/src/com/android/tv/analytics/ |
H A D | StubTracker.java | 105 public void sendInputConnectionFailure(String inputId) { } argument 108 public void sendInputDisconnected(String inputId) { } argument
|
H A D | Tracker.java | 194 * <p><strong>WARNING</strong> callers must ensure no PII is included in the inputId. 196 * @param inputId the input the failure happened on 198 void sendInputConnectionFailure(String inputId); argument 202 * <p><strong>WARNING</strong> callers must ensure no PII is included in the inputId. 204 * @param inputId the input the failure happened on 206 void sendInputDisconnected(String inputId); argument
|
/packages/apps/TV/src/com/android/tv/search/ |
H A D | TvProviderSearch.java | 479 private SearchResult buildSearchResultForInput(String inputId) { argument 482 result.intentData = TvContract.buildChannelUriForPassthroughInput(inputId).toString();
|
/packages/apps/TV/src/com/android/tv/util/ |
H A D | ImageLoader.java | 408 public static String getTvInputLogoKey(String inputId) { argument 409 return inputId + "-logo";
|
H A D | PipInputManager.java | 53 private final Map<String, PipInput> mPipInputMap = new HashMap<>(); // inputId -> PipInput 58 public void onInputAdded(String inputId) { 59 TvInputInfo input = mInputManager.getTvInputInfo(inputId); 63 mPipInputMap.put(inputId, new PipInput(inputId, available)); 76 public void onInputRemoved(String inputId) { 77 PipInput pipInput = mPipInputMap.remove(inputId); 80 Log.w(TAG, "A TV input (" + inputId + ") isn't tracked in PipInputManager"); 94 public void onInputStateChanged(String inputId, int state) { 95 PipInput pipInput = mPipInputMap.get(inputId); 325 PipInput(String inputId, boolean available) argument [all...] |
H A D | SetupUtils.java | 104 public void onTvInputSetupFinished(final String inputId, argument 109 // list again and make all channels of {@code inputId} browsable. 110 onSetupDone(inputId); 117 updateChannelBrowsable(mTvApplication, inputId, postRunnable); 127 updateChannelBrowsable(mTvApplication, inputId, postRunnable); 131 private static void updateChannelBrowsable(Context context, final String inputId, argument 140 if (channel.getInputId().equals(inputId)) { 168 String inputId = input.getId(); 169 if (!isSetupDone(inputId) && channelDataManager.getChannelCountForInput(inputId) > 196 isNewInput(String inputId) argument 204 markAsKnownInput(String inputId) argument 214 isSetupDone(String inputId) argument 237 isRecognizedInput(String inputId) argument 367 onSetupDone(String inputId) argument [all...] |
H A D | TvInputManagerHelper.java | 55 public void onInputStateChanged(String inputId, int state) { 56 if (DEBUG) Log.d(TAG, "onInputStateChanged " + inputId + " state=" + state); 57 if (isInBlackList(inputId)) { 60 mInputStateMap.put(inputId, state); 62 callback.onInputStateChanged(inputId, state); 67 public void onInputAdded(String inputId) { 68 if (DEBUG) Log.d(TAG, "onInputAdded " + inputId); 69 if (isInBlackList(inputId)) { 72 TvInputInfo info = mTvInputManager.getTvInputInfo(inputId); 74 mInputMap.put(inputId, inf 234 isPartnerInput(String inputId) argument 254 hasTvInputInfo(String inputId) argument 260 getTvInputInfo(String inputId) argument 272 getTvInputAppInfo(String inputId) argument 291 getInputState(String inputId) argument 324 isInBlackList(String inputId) argument [all...] |
/packages/apps/TV/tests/unit/src/com/android/tv/dvr/ |
H A D | DvrDataManagerInMemoryImpl.java | 85 public List<SeriesRecording> getSeriesRecordings(String inputId) { argument 88 if (TextUtils.equals(r.getInputId(), inputId)) { 133 public List<ScheduledRecording> getScheduledRecordings(String inputId) { argument 136 if (TextUtils.equals(r.getInputId(), inputId)) {
|